In your book you mention that GAPS people often have an overgrowth of sulphate-reducing bacteria. If I suspect this to be the case in my child, should I avoid feeding him foods that contain high amount of sulphur? No, do not remove sulphur-containing foods! Sulphur is essential to re-build you child’s gut, immunity and liver function. GAPS people are already deficient in sulphur; they cannot get enough of it. As the gut flora starts changing the beneficial microbes will take care of the pathogens and normalise your child’s sulphur metabolism.
